RVI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

148 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Retail Value Inc. Common Shares (RVI)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$529M — up 4.1% from $508M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 20 funds opened new RVI positions and 16 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 39 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Indaba Capital Management, adding an estimated $3.75M. The largest seller was Newtyn Management, cutting an estimated $2.74M.
